FC glass sunroof

How rare are these?or are they common? How much are they worth paying for? I am not talking about plexiglass, i am talking about the OEM ones.

there is no OEM moonroof... there was a few companies that made them for the FC, pacific glass as i recall is one of the better suppliers.

the glass usually runs $200-400 used. there is no more companies that make the glass as far as i know.

Actually they were Dealer Options. There were 2 main vendors:

Pacific Glass: Company is defunct

Saratoga T-Tops: Company is still in business, now headquartered out of NC. When thay moved from NY all the molds were lost/destroyed. Please do not bug them trying to get them to retool and remake them. They want a 10,000 unit min. order.
